Support new SIP Inbound/Outbound Trunk API and move all SIP commands into a separate cli tree:
list-sip-trunk->sip trunk listlist-sip-dispatch-rule->sip dispatch listcreate-sip-participant->sip participant createOld commands continue to work, they are only hidden from the CLI help.
I also renamed the columns for legacy trunks list command. Now they match names in new API (
OutboundNumber->Number,InboundNumbers->AllowedNumbers).Requires livekit/protocol#738
